I think this is how they are scored, save having to search back. (y)

Remember it's 3 pts for a correct score, 2 pts for a correct margin and 1 pt for a correct result -

Example: Predict 1-0 Result 1-0 3 pts, 2-1 2pts, 2-0 1pt

Bonus Points: 6 correct results 1 pt, 8 correct results a further 1 pt
Correct First Scorer 2pts
No tiebreakers apply to League games.
